Specially developed for dogs with chronic renal failure, Advance Veterinary Diets Renal features a balanced formula designed to relieve the kidneys and support their function. The dietary dry food has a moderate content of high-quality proteins and contains only little phosphorus.Analytical constituents
protein | 14.5 % |
fat | 17.5 % |
fibre | 3.0 % |
ash | 4.5 % |
calcium | 0.8 % |
phosphorus | 0.3 % |
potassium | 0.6 % |
sodium | 0.25 % |
omega-3 fats | 0.5 % |
omega-6 fats | 2.8 % |
Weight of the dog | Dry food (g/day) |
1 kg | 30 g |
3 kg | 65 g |
5 kg | 95 g |
10 kg | 165 g |
15 kg | 220 g |
20 kg | 275 g |
25 kg | 325 g |
30 kg | 370 g |
35 kg | 415 g |
40 kg | 460 g |
45 kg | 505 g |
50 kg | 545 g |
55 kg | 585 g |
60 kg | 625 g |
65 kg | 660 g |
70 kg | 700 g |
1. The recommended amounts of food are guidelines and must be adapted to the actual energy requirements of the animal. The energy requirements of a dog depend on the housing conditions, ambient temperature, activity level, body condition and size of the breed. Small breeds may require 15% to 25% more energy per 500 g of body mass than larger dogs. The daily ration should be divided into several meals. Please always provide your dog with fresh water.
